Why is a tanker truck hauling diesel gas more expensive to haul than the same tanker hauling gas?
Most tankers can haul around 8500 gallons of gasoline and the same unit can only haul around 7500 gallons of diesel due to the weight difference between gasoline and diesel. Diesel weighs around 7 lbs per gallon while gasoilne weighs around 5.9 lbs per gallons provided the product is around 60 degrees, thus meaning that during the winter product is heavier and during the summer it is lighter.
